Just wanted to let you know that episode two of the podcast is now available to listen to at anchor.fm/dan-barker2.

In this instalment we take a look at the early part of the 20th century from 1900-1914. We look back at Town’s Second Division title win, brief stay in the top flight, a tumble down the leagues and subsequent departure from the football league as well as our triumphant return. We also pay tribute to the Mariners who gave their lives for their country as football took a backseat when war raged on in Europe.
